Kensington and Chelsea's Autism and Early Years Intervention Team invite parents/carers of an older child or young person with autism to participate in their regular Cygnet Training courses. 

The Barnardo’s Cygnet Training is an award-winning parenting support programme for parents/carers of children and young people (aged 5-18) diagnosed with an autism spectrum disorder. The course includes seven sessions and covers the following topics:

  • What is Autism?
  • Describing Autism - strengths and challenges
  • Sensory Needs
  • Communication 
  • Understanding Behaviour
  • Supporting Behaviour
